What is a capacitor?
A capacitor consists of two pieces of metal separated by a dielectric material
A. Look at the diagram. When the switch is closed, which of the following statements about the capacitor will be true?
The charge on the capacitor will increase and the potential difference across it will increase
When the capacitor is fully charged, the potential difference across it will be:
Equal to the e.m.f. of the cell
The capacitance C of a capacitor that stores a charge Q with a potential difference V is given by:
C=Q/V
B. The unit of capacitance is the Farad. One Farad is equal to:
1CV-1
What will happen to the capacitance if the potential difference is doubled?
The capacitance will stay the same
